About Yang Jin
Yang Jin is a scholar working on Cancer Research, Molecular Biology and Aging, having authored 57 papers that have together received 2.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Extracellular vesicles in disease (32 papers), MicroRNA in disease regulation (25 papers) and Circular RNAs in diseases (11 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cancer Research (1.1k citations), Molecular Biology (2.0k citations) and Immunology (360 citations). Yang Jin has collaborated with scholars based in United States, South Korea and China. Frequent co-authors include Heedoo Lee, Duo Zhang, Jonathan M. Carnino, Ziwen Zhu, Michael Groot, Charles S. Dela Cruz, Jasleen Minhas, Augustine M.K. Choi, Zhi Hao Kwok and Leo E. Otterbein.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, The Journal of Experimental Medicine and S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ología.
